If a person's brain has a low level of neurotransmitters, it has several implications. Neurotransmitters are chemicals that transmit signals from one neuron to another across synapses. They play a critical role in the proper functioning of our central nervous system (CNS), which includes the brain and spinal cord. An abnormally low level of a neurotransmitter can affect brain regions that control specific functions. For example, low levels of dopamine can negatively impact the part of the brain responsible for movement, leading to disorders like Parkinson's Disease.
Low levels of another neurotransmitter, serotonin, are often associated with depression. Antidepressants work by increasing serotonin levels, helping to control symptoms and improve the quality of life for those with depression. Furthermore, neurotransmitter imbalances are thought to play roles in anxiety, bipolar disorder, schizophrenia, and ADHD. A lack of neurotransmitters means that neurons would not be able to receive input properly, leading to physical and mental disorders.
It's also important to note that neurotransmitter levels can be affected by psychoactive drugs, which can either increase or decrease the activity of these crucial chemicals in the brain. Antagonists reduce the activity by blocking neurotransmitter binding, whereas agonists increase activity in various ways, including mimicking the neurotransmitter's action.
